Boxer

large

Energetic, fun-loving dogs known for their goofy personalities and athleticism.

Keep lineage notes tidy with GenogramCraft right alongside your growth tracking.

Adult Weight
50-80 lbs
Lifespan
10-12 years
Temperament
Bright, Fun-Loving, Active
Exercise
60 minutes of vigorous play daily

Developmental Milestones

0-2 weeks

Physical Development
Eyes and ears closed, depends on mother
Behavioral Development
Limited movement, nursing

2-4 weeks

Physical Development
Eyes and ears open, teeth begin to emerge
Behavioral Development
Starts walking, exploring

4-8 weeks

Physical Development
Weaning begins, rapid growth
Behavioral Development
Socialization with littermates, play behavior

8-12 weeks

Physical Development
Baby teeth fully in, growth continues
Behavioral Development
Critical socialization period, fear imprint period

3-6 months

Physical Development
Adult teeth coming in, puberty begins
Behavioral Development
Testing boundaries, second fear period

6-12 months

Physical Development
Sexual maturity, growth slowing
Behavioral Development
Adolescence, energy peaks

12-18 months

Physical Development
Reaches adult size, growth plates close
Behavioral Development
Mental maturity developing

Care Requirements

Grooming

Low – weekly brushing

Exercise

60 minutes of vigorous play daily

Common Health Issues

  • • Cardiomyopathy
  • • Cancer
  • • Hypothyroidism
